The Blue Jay robots extra set of hands probably means Amazons warehouses will require fewer human hands.
The Blue Jay robots extra set of hands probably means A… [+4068 chars]read more
The Blue Jay robots extra set of hands probably means Amazons warehouses will require fewer human hands.
The Blue Jay robots extra set of hands probably means A… [+4068 chars]read more